If our partners for marriage are predetermined by Allah Ta’ala, then why do we recite the 500 durood for marriage?

Answered as per Hanafi Fiqh by Askimam.org
Answer

Taqdeer (predestination) simply means that everything is within Divine
measure and is in the complete and absolute knowledge of Allah Ta’ala.
However, this world is Daarul Asbaab (world of means and effect). We have to
adopt means to achieve anything.

A person’s children are predetermined but he has to adopt a means to have
children by marrying. A person’s sustenance is predetermined but a person
has to go out in search of his sustenance. Taqdeer and adopting means are
not inconsistent to one another. It is our belief that the effect in our
means will be according to whatever was in the absolute knowledge of Allah
Ta’ala – Taqdeer. Reciting 500 times Durood is similar to adopting effective
means to achieve one’s objective. The reciting of Durood 500 times has been
proven to be an effective means to get a suitable marriage partner, but the
marriage partner will be ultimately according to Taqdeer.
